Former senator Antonio Trillanes IV is reportedly setting his sights on running for mayor of Caloocan in 2025, setting himself up for a faceoff with the Malapitan family that has ruled the city for over a decade.
An Iskooper told Politiko that Trillanes has started making the rounds of communities in Caloocan to listen to people’s concerns and touch base with local leaders.
